mirror of
https://github.com/novatiq/packages.git
synced 2026-04-30 15:38:40 +01:00
ocserv: simplify IPv6 network setting
Signed-off-by: Nikos Mavrogiannopoulos <nmav@gnutls.org>
This commit is contained in:
@@ -268,7 +268,6 @@ ipv4-netmask = |NETMASK|
|
|||||||
|
|
||||||
# The IPv6 subnet that leases will be given from.
|
# The IPv6 subnet that leases will be given from.
|
||||||
|ENABLE_IPV6|ipv6-network = |IPV6ADDR|
|
|ENABLE_IPV6|ipv6-network = |IPV6ADDR|
|
||||||
|ENABLE_IPV6|ipv6-prefix = |IPV6PREFIX|
|
|
||||||
|
|
||||||
# The domains over which the provided DNS should be used. Use
|
# The domains over which the provided DNS should be used. Use
|
||||||
# multiple lines for multiple domains.
|
# multiple lines for multiple domains.
|
||||||
|
|||||||
@@ -31,9 +31,6 @@ setup_config() {
|
|||||||
test -z $default_domain && enable_default_domain=""
|
test -z $default_domain && enable_default_domain=""
|
||||||
test -z $ip6addr && enable_ipv6="#"
|
test -z $ip6addr && enable_ipv6="#"
|
||||||
|
|
||||||
ipv6_addr=`echo $ip6addr|cut -d '/' -f 1`
|
|
||||||
ipv6_prefix=`echo $ip6addr|cut -d '/' -f 2`
|
|
||||||
|
|
||||||
test $auth = "plain" && authsuffix="\[passwd=/var/etc/ocpasswd\]"
|
test $auth = "plain" && authsuffix="\[passwd=/var/etc/ocpasswd\]"
|
||||||
|
|
||||||
dyndns="false"
|
dyndns="false"
|
||||||
@@ -55,8 +52,7 @@ setup_config() {
|
|||||||
-e "s/|COMPRESSION|/$enable_compression/g" \
|
-e "s/|COMPRESSION|/$enable_compression/g" \
|
||||||
-e "s/|IPV4ADDR|/$ipaddr/g" \
|
-e "s/|IPV4ADDR|/$ipaddr/g" \
|
||||||
-e "s/|NETMASK|/$netmask/g" \
|
-e "s/|NETMASK|/$netmask/g" \
|
||||||
-e "s/|IPV6ADDR|/$ipv6_addr/g" \
|
-e "s#|IPV6ADDR|#$ip6addr#g" \
|
||||||
-e "s/|IPV6PREFIX|/$ipv6_prefix/g" \
|
|
||||||
-e "s/|ENABLE_IPV6|/$enable_ipv6/g" \
|
-e "s/|ENABLE_IPV6|/$enable_ipv6/g" \
|
||||||
/etc/ocserv/ocserv.conf.template > /var/etc/ocserv.conf
|
/etc/ocserv/ocserv.conf.template > /var/etc/ocserv.conf
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user